This Mustang was a Barn Find last year from the California Southern Desert. The is a California car, made in San Jose and has never left the State of California. Engine is the original 289 C  Code V-8. Came with a 2 Barrel Carb that I still have in my possession, along with the original 2 Barrel cast-iron intake that goes with car upon sale but has been replaced by a correct date-coded  A Code 4 Barrel Cast Iron intake and correct 1965 dated Autolite 4100 Carburetor for a small-block ford. The only other non-original drive train parts under the hood are the Pertronix kit and I replaced a missing A/C Compressor with a modern A/C Compressor from Classic Air. The car was equipped with Factory A/C.  Where do I start? This car is really nice, runs great, and has the following: Factory Power Steering that was rebuilt along with new hoses. I added Power front Disc Brakes so the car could be safely driven. Factory A/C-the original Condenser was cleaned out and the Evaporator was replaced with a larger unit from Classic Air to increase the cooling capacity. You cannot see this upgrade, its deep inside the O.E. under-dash mounted A/C that was also in a kit. Rebuilt motor [before I bought the car] but I didn't like the heads, so I replaced them with correct newly rebuilt correct date-coded 1966 heads with H.D. valve springs. The old heads go with the sale.  All re-chromed OE parts with the exception of the 289 badges on the fenders. All the aluminum and stainless Steel was polished. The seats are original; I just had a couple of seams that had mildly split, repaired. Brand new modern Radio from Classic Auto Sound with iPhone hookup. 2 added rear speakers in the Package Tray area. Completely newly painted interior with Acrylic Enamel. Brand new Carpet kit. Exterior was painted a year ago in Code F, Arcadian Blue, the OE Color. The paint is base/clear, really shiny and just to be 100% honest, has a handful of bubbles in the Left front door [I'm so pissed!!] that you could have fixed or just leave them alone. There are some stone chips that I've touched up. Original Quarter Panels for sure. Original floor pans too. New Heater core/box/rebuilt heater fan. New defroster hoses that actually work. Brand new windshield. New Headliner and Sun Visors in dark blue. New matching blue Dash Pad. All new weatherstripping throughout, even deep inside the doors!! New Fuel tank and sending unit. New shocks throughout. Just put front perches and upper control arms on 90 days ago. Even after the new heads were put on, since the temperature gauge stays 1/2 way between C and H, even after the car warms up, So I put in a brand new water pump/thermostat, hoses, a Flex Fan, a Trans cooler and thermostatically controlled Hayden electric fan. I modified the hood latch so the car's hood cannot be opened without a special fabricated tool that goes with car to make room for the Hayden Fan. The cooling system was just pressure tested and held 13 psi. Compression Readings are normal as well as Vacuum Readings at idle.  There is also a brand new 3 row Radiator too!! Believe it or not, the car has a rebuilt C4 transmission, with receipts,that has less than 50 miles on it!!  The repaint is not a $20k repaint, but a nice quality 4k paint job. The car was painted with all the windows and chrome removed, so all the gaskets have no overspray on them. The paint is super shiny and just freshly detailed.  I have the O.E Hubcaps, but look how nice the Ford Wheels are now, along with brand new radial tires.
